Beyond the Blue Mountains is a unique project. Based on Kentucky writer Jane Wilson Joyce’s book of the same name, LFL explores her evocative poetry through ensemble storytelling and movement to recreate one Boyle County, Kentucky family’s experiences on the Oregon Trail. Gabe Clay has Oregon fever, 13-year old Nancy is filled with impatience, teen Abby anticipates how her life will change with Gus Whittier part of the wagon train, and mother Sarah has a sense of foreboding at the journey’s upheaval. Join these and other characters of the wagon train as LFL’s performers move easily between characters in their signature approach to theatre.

Looking for Lilith has a strong commitment to education. In our outreach programs, we can guide participants in researching, devising, and sharing new works that give voice to the members of our society who have historically been underrepresented. Through these programs and our performances, we help show the value of multiple perspectives on history.

Looking  for Lilith provides touring productions, in-school residencies and after-school programs for pre-K through 12th grade, including our award-winning interactive performance, Choices. We also offer professional development opportunities for teachers.
